What Key Features Should You Look for in a Backpacking Air Pad?
When searching for the best air pads for backpacking, consider the following key features:
- R-Value: The R-value measures the thermal resistance of the air pad, which indicates its ability to insulate against the cold ground. A higher R-value means better insulation, making it suitable for colder conditions, while a lower R-value is suitable for warmer weather.
- Packability: The ability to compress and pack the air pad into a small size is crucial for backpacking, where space and weight are limited. Look for pads that can be rolled or folded to fit easily into your backpack without taking up too much room.
- Weight: Weight is a significant factor for backpackers, as every ounce counts during long hikes. Lightweight air pads are often made with advanced materials that provide durability without adding unnecessary weight, making them easier to carry over long distances.
- Durability: A durable air pad should withstand rough terrain and resist punctures or abrasions. Look for pads made from high-denier fabrics, which offer better resistance to wear and tear while still being lightweight.
- Inflation and Deflation: Consider how easy it is to inflate and deflate the air pad. Some models feature built-in pumps, quick inflation valves, or self-inflating designs, which can save time and effort when setting up or packing away.
- Comfort: Comfort is key for a good night’s sleep while backpacking. Look for air pads with sufficient thickness and supportive designs that contour to your body, ensuring a restful sleep on uneven ground.
- Noise Level: Some air pads can be noisy when you shift during the night, which may disrupt your sleep. Look for pads designed with quieter materials or construction methods to minimize noise and enhance your camping experience.
- Temperature Rating: Different air pads are designed for varying temperature conditions, so check the manufacturer’s temperature rating to ensure the pad suits your typical camping environment. This feature helps you choose one that will keep you warm in cooler weather or cool in warmer conditions.

How Can You Properly Inflate and Maintain Your Backpacking Air Pad?
To properly inflate and maintain your backpacking air pad, follow these essential steps:
- Choosing the Right Pump: Select a pump that is compatible with your air pad to ensure efficient inflation and to avoid damage.
- Inflation Techniques: Utilize various inflation methods such as using your breath, a pump sack, or an electric pump to achieve the desired firmness without over-inflating.
- Regular Inspections: Periodically check your air pad for leaks or punctures by submerging it in water or listening for hissing sounds, allowing for timely repairs.
- Cleaning and Maintenance: Clean your air pad with mild soap and water after each trip to remove dirt and oils, and store it in a cool, dry place to prolong its lifespan.
- Temperature Considerations: Be mindful of temperature changes, as extreme heat or cold can affect the air pressure within the pad, leading to discomfort during use.
Choosing the Right Pump: The efficiency of inflating your air pad largely depends on the pump you select. A hand pump or a pump sack can help you avoid moisture from your breath entering the pad, which can lead to mold growth over time. Ensure that your pump is designed for your specific air pad model to prevent any damage during the inflation process.
Inflation Techniques: Proper inflation is key to comfort while sleeping. If using your breath, be cautious of over-inflating; a pad that is too firm can lead to discomfort. Using a pump sack can save you energy and help maintain the internal environment of the pad, while electric pumps can provide quick inflation but may introduce moisture.
Regular Inspections: Checking your air pad for leaks is crucial before heading out on a trip. A quick inspection can involve running your hands along the seams and surface, or even submerging it in water to spot air bubbles. Addressing any punctures or leaks immediately can save you from a sleepless night on the trail.
Cleaning and Maintenance: After each use, it’s important to clean your air pad to prevent the accumulation of dirt and bacteria. Use a soft cloth with a solution of mild soap and water, then rinse thoroughly and let it air dry before storing. Proper storage in a breathable bag away from direct sunlight will help maintain the integrity of the materials.
Temperature Considerations: Air pads can expand or contract based on the surrounding temperature, so it’s important to consider this during inflation. In cold conditions, the air inside the pad may compress, leading to a lower firmness. Conversely, in hot conditions, it may expand too much, causing discomfort, so adjust accordingly to find the right balance for a good night’s rest.

How Can You Avoid Leaks and Extend the Lifespan of Your Air Pad?
To avoid leaks and extend the lifespan of your air pad, consider the following essential tips:
- Proper Storage: Always store your air pad in a cool, dry place, away from direct sunlight and extreme temperatures.
- Regular Inspection: Frequently check your air pad for any signs of wear, tears, or punctures to address issues before they worsen.
- Use a Ground Layer: Place a protective layer, like a tarp or footprint, beneath your air pad to shield it from sharp objects and rough terrain.
- Inflation Technique: Avoid over-inflating your pad, as excessive pressure can lead to seams bursting and material fatigue.
- Clean Maintenance: Clean your air pad regularly with mild soap and water to remove dirt and debris that can create wear points.
Proper Storage: Storing your air pad in a cool, dry environment helps to prevent the material from degrading. Exposure to UV rays and high temperatures can weaken the fabric and increase the risk of leaks over time.
Regular Inspection: Conducting regular inspections allows you to catch small punctures or tears early. By addressing these issues promptly, you can prevent larger leaks that could render your pad unusable during a trip.
Use a Ground Layer: By utilizing a tarp or footprint, you create a barrier between your air pad and the ground. This additional layer prevents sharp objects like rocks or sticks from puncturing your pad, significantly extending its life.
Inflation Technique: Inflating your air pad to the recommended pressure ensures optimal comfort while minimizing the risk of damage. Over-inflating can stretch the materials beyond their capacity, leading to potential failures at the seams.
Clean Maintenance: Keeping your air pad clean helps prevent dirt and grit from wearing down the material. A simple wash with mild soap and water can keep it in good condition and free from abrasive particles.
